Very satisfied. Justified expectations. It definitely costs me from 6 to 8. Has some pros I switched to iPhone 8 Plus 64GB from iPhone 6 128GB. Therefore, the review will be in comparison. 1. Cool material. Aluminum is not as pleasant to the touch. Here the glass sits very tightly in the hand and does not slip. 2. Screen size. A purely personal factor. Very comfortable in a man's hand. More information on the screen. 3. Color rendition. After the "six" is space. The eye rejoices. 4. Home button. Cool stuff, nothing more. 5. The camera is space. Portrait mode is the plague. They are worth buying for. 6. Speed ββof work. I had a 4S recently in my hands. So it still works smoothly. After three years with the six, the response is certainly steeper. 7. Sound. It got louder and more voluminous. 8. Wireless charging. The theme is cool, I think. But I haven't used it yet. Its cons: They are sucked from the finger: 1. Weight. He became heavier than all his predecessors (plus'ov). 2. Design. It's outdated. I had a big gap between generations of phones, so I decided not to wait for a new design.
